Controlling the audio device (Bluetooth connection)

If your Bluetooth device supports the device operating function (compatible protocol: AVRCP), then the following
operations are available. The available functions may vary depending on the Bluetooth device, so refer to the operating
instructions supplied with the device.
You can use the touch sensor on the right unit to perform the following operations.
Play/Pause: Tap the touch sensor.
Skip to the beginning of the next track: Tap twice quickly (with an interval of about 0.4 seconds).
Skip to the beginning of the previous track (or the current track during playback): Tap 3 times quickly (with an interval
of about 0.4 seconds).
Note
You cannot adjust the volume on the headset. Adjust the volume on the connected device. If you are unable to adjust the volume
on the connected device, install the "Sony | Headphones Connect" smartphone app and adjust the volume in the app.
If the communication condition is poor, the Bluetooth device may react incorrectly to the operation on the headset.
The available functions may vary depending on the connected device. In some cases, it may operate differently or may not work
at all even when the operations described above are performed.
